Key ceremony checklist — item 7 (LiftSim support handoff)

Confirm the signing key for the LiftSim elevator-dispatch simulator has been rotated and the old key destroyed in front of both witnesses. Support team: after this step, customer-facing simulator builds will be signed with the new key, so cached installers from before today will show a signature warning — that's expected, just reissue the download link. To activate the new key in the escrow module, enter the recovery passphrase below.

unlock words, yawig-kagef: gordor-holvan-ulaael-pramir-ulaiel-tamdor

Handover — Vexler partner SFTP drop

Ownership moves to you today. Drop runs hourly from Vexler's end into the intake bucket via the relay host. Watch for zero-byte files; their exporter flakes on Mondays. Creds live in the ops vault, path noted in the runbook. Vault auto-seals after 48h idle. Support escalations go to the on-call rotation, not me. If the vault is sealed when you need it, unseal with the recovery passphrase below.

recovery phrase for tadug-fafof: zorwyn-kasion

Root cause: our 3.2 release changed the default font-metric stub used during snapshot rendering, so every baseline image shifted by two pixels. Plugin authors: this was not a fault in your components. We have restored the old stub behind a compatibility flag and regenerated the canonical baselines. If your pipeline pinned our renderer, rebaseline against the restored stub. The corrected renderer build is identified by the token below.

session token of kawip-yajeg = htk6_209e95